cAMP modulates an S-type K+ channel coupled to GABAB receptors in mammalian respiratory neurons

PG Wagner, MS Dekin - Neuroreport, 1997 - journals.lww.com
PREMOTOR respiratory neurons from neonatal rats express a Ba 2+-insensitive outward
rectifying K+ channel (K OR) which is activated by γ-aminobutyric acid acting at its β
receptor. The biophysical properties of K OR are similar to those described for the S-channel
(KS) which underlies simple forms of non-associative learning in the marine mollusc Aplysia.
We show here that K OR, like the S-channel, is inhibited by cAMP. In addition, we
demonstrate that this inhibition is due to a change in closed time kinetics. Our data suggests …
